Output 7840c53abd89e0e65301be3cf55e1732ff5d1d220b4446dfc7dbedeb4fbd2d5e:0

value
75378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ffc00953610ffdfcb76b59a54aafe73280ce3c OP_EQUAL
address
3DYPU7zGyXpYmEYDaAwpZqaSCqrbsWiPZZ
transaction
7840c53abd89e0e65301be3cf55e1732ff5d1d220b4446dfc7dbedeb4fbd2d5e
confirmations
222872
spent
true